

Romney Super PAC launches $7 million ad campaign, fundraises with potential VPs
The Super PAC supporting Mitt Romney is making a $7 million ad buy across eight battleground states, and will look to bring even more money in with a high-profile New York City fundraiser featuring Sens. Marco Rubio (R-Fla.) and Kelly Ayotte (R-N.H.).
The group has purchased a ten-day ad blitz across Colorado, Florida, Iowa, Nevada, New Hampshire, North Carolina, Ohio, and Pennsylvania according to a report in the Washington Post. The ads will begin airing on Wednesday.
The effort comes just days after casino mogul Sheldon Adelson signaled that he would be donating some $10 million to the group. Adelson, a prominent conservative donor who supported Newt Gingrich in the GOP primary, made his after a face-to-face meeting with Romney in Las Vegas late last month.
Both senators have appeared frequently on the campaign trail with Romney, and, hailing from crucial swing states, considered top contenders for his vice presidential nomination.
Restore Our Future was a potent weapon for Romney during the Republican primary, spending more than $40 million to aid his candidacy. The group has far outpaced fundraising on the Democrats' side, leading to some fears among the Obama team that they could be dramatically outspent by November.
